Tropical Storm Karen
Written on October 3, 2013 at 9:07 am, by Adam Cuker
Tropical Storm Karen forms over the southeastern Gulf Of Mexico. The tropical storm is approximately 500 miles south of the mouth of the Mississippi River with maximum sustained winds at 60 MPH.
